Mildred T. Barnes' Obituary
Mildred T. Barnes, 93, of Decatur died Thursday May 7, 2009 in St. Mary’s Hospital.
Homegoing Celebration will be 11:00 am Friday May 15, 2009 in Antioch Missionary Baptist Church with Pastor, Rev. Dr. C.D. Stuart officiating. Visitation will be one hour before service in the church. Burial will be in Macon County Memorial Park.
Mildred was born on September 17, 1915 in Prairie, Mississippi the daughter of Ike and Louise Davenport Tolliver. She was a homemaker and a member of Antioch Missionary Baptist Church. She married Willie J. Barnes Sr. on December 18, 1934 in Osceola, AR he preceded her in death in 1990.
She leaves not to mourn but to cherish fond memories sons, Willie J. Barnes Jr. of Decatur; Johnnie H. Barnes Yvonda of Urbana; Kenneth Barnes of Rockford; daughter, Jimmie Lee Mitchell Cornell of Decatur; sisters, Beatrice King of Decatur; Luhenry Johnson of Peoria; 18 grandchildren, and a host of great-grandchildren, great-great-grandchildren, nieces, nephews, and cousins.
She was preceded in death by her parents, husband, three sisters, and one brother.
